1. 程式人生 > >Spring boot 線上部署

Spring boot 線上部署

dir 多個 -m color temp plugins pen pat 參數

1.修改Spring Boot

1.添加:spring-boot-maven-plugin 插件

<build>
  <plugins>
    <plugin>
      <groupId>org.springframework.boot</groupId>
      <artifactId>spring-boot-maven-plugin</artifactId>
    </plugin>
  </plugins>
</build>

打包格式按照:

<groupId>com.smartom</groupId>
<!--打包按照這個名稱進行打包-->
<artifactId>MyWeb</artifactId>
<!--打包生成的版本號-->
<version>0.0.1</version>

2.進行打包

mvn package

3.運行

java -jar xxxx.jar 

其他問題:

1.第三方包 打包

mvn 打包
mvn install:install-file -Dfile=lib\jdom.jar -DgroupId=org.jdom -DartifactId=jdom -Dversion=1.1
.0 -Dpackaging=jar -DgeneratePom=true
重要參數:
Dfile:打包路徑
DgroupId:對應 groupid
DartifactId: 對應artifactId
Dversion:對應版本號

然後在加入pom.xml文件
  <dependency>
      <groupId>org.jdom</groupId>
      <artifactId>jdom</artifactId>
      <version>1.1.0</version>
    </
dependency>

pom.xml加載本地jar包

<dependency>

    <groupId>org.wltea.analyzer</groupId>
    <artifactId>IKAnalyzer</artifactId>
    <version>2012_u6</version>
    <scope>system</scope>
    <systemPath>${project.basedir}/lib/jdom.jar
</systemPath> </dependency>

2.項目中包含多個main

Spring boot 線上部署